About
As a member of the LGBTQ2S+ community, it can be extremely difficult to find a safe space that offers kindness, understanding, and support without judgement. It is my mission to provide a safe space for the LGBTQ2S+ community to receive therapy, support, and work towards living the best life they can live. Whether you're questioning your sexuality or gender, working on coming out to loved ones, navigating a new space for the first time, or just need to work on life issues, this is a place where you can do so without fear of judgement.
I specialize in working with the LGBTQ2S+ community and, specifically, the transgender community, helping individuals navigate the transition process. I also work with clients experiencing stress, anxiety, depression, interpersonal issues, and those who are looking to make general improvements in their life.
My therapeutic process focuses on the individual and what they need, and I want to work with you (not just for you) to help you live the best life you can live. I work to get to know my clients and help them navigate through life as best as they can, while providing support to help them do so.
